+# Prefer -pthread to -lpthread for find_package(Threads ...)
+#
+# std::thread code compiled only with -lpthread emits the following runtime error (on GCC 4.8.4)
+#
+# terminate called after throwing an instance of 'std::system_error'
+# what(): Enable multithreading to use std::thread: Operation not permitted
+#
+set(THREADS_PREFER_PTHREAD_FLAG TRUE)
